**Changelog — Tailspout CLI v1.8**

The setting `TS_FOLLOW_KEY` has been renamed to `TAILSPOUT_STREAM_TOKEN_PATH` to better reflect its purpose. Plugin authors should update any scaffolding that generates env files; the old name will be removed in v2.0. No behavioral changes: the CLI still authenticates to the log broker at startup before tailing begins. Plugins that invoke the CLI directly must ensure the broker credential is present in the environment, set on the following line:

secret setting of yagef-baweg: RELAY_SECRET29=cb53deb59a49ed54d9f43599b54ca

The proposed shift from monthly to annual billing for the Larkfield platform was examined in detail. Modelling suggests improved cash predictability and a modest reduction in churn, offset by a one-time deferred revenue adjustment of material size in Q1. Collections workload should fall by roughly a third, though the Pellbrook support desk anticipates a spike in renewal queries. Heads of department should weigh these trade-offs carefully before the vote, noting the confidential planning context appended below.

confidential, bahof-yaweg: Headcount on the Kaseth team goes from 32 to 109 by the end of January. Gross margin on Kaseth came in at 46 percent against a plan of 45 percent.

## On-call: Greenhouse Controller Drift (Fernhollow)

If zone temps disagree with the reference probe by more than 1.5°C, the drift compensator has stalled. Restart the controller service, then verify DRIFT_POLL_SECONDS=60 and COMPENSATOR_MODE=auto in the env file. The compensator pulls calibration curves from the hub, and the env file must set its pull credential on the next line.

vault entry, yajop-bafop: ARCHIVE_KEY3=8d4

FINANCE REVIEW SUMMARY — Pricing, Coralite Product Line

The Coralite line remains margin-positive, though unit economics have weakened since the input cost increases last spring. A 3–5% list price adjustment is modeled as sustainable without material volume loss. Bundled pricing with the Averon accessories range shows promise in pilot data. Department heads should review the confidential planning note below before the pricing committee meets.

board note of fahog-bawep: The renewal with Holixax Holdings closes at $20 million a year, 20 percent below the last contract. Project Druwyn slips by two quarters because of the supplier delay.